门电路与组合逻辑电路

上传人:宝路 文档编号:52452872 上传时间:2018-08-21 格式:PPT 页数:71 大小:1.71MB
返回 下载 相关 举报
门电路与组合逻辑电路_第1页
第1页 / 共71页
门电路与组合逻辑电路_第2页
第2页 / 共71页
门电路与组合逻辑电路_第3页
第3页 / 共71页
门电路与组合逻辑电路_第4页
第4页 / 共71页
门电路与组合逻辑电路_第5页
第5页 / 共71页
点击查看更多>>
资源描述

《门电路与组合逻辑电路》由会员分享,可在线阅读,更多相关《门电路与组合逻辑电路(71页珍藏版)》请在金锄头文库上搜索。

1、第 8 章门电路与组合逻辑电路概 述电子线路按其功能、性质的不同分为模拟电路与 数字电路两大类。模拟电路可用来实现幅度随时间连续变化的模 拟信号的产生和处理,如前面分析的各种放大电路 都属于此类。数字电路主要是对在时间和大小上都是离散的数 字信号进行存储、变换和运算处理的电路。在数字电路中,按其完成逻辑功能的不同特点, 可划分为组合逻辑电路和时序逻辑电路两大类。本 章讨论组合逻辑电路。所谓组合逻辑电路是指该电路在任一时刻的稳 定输出状态,仅取决于该时刻输入信号的组合,而 与输入信号作用前电路所处的状态无关。在数字电路中的晶体管只有两种工作状态:饱和导通 时,集电极输出低电平;截 止时,集电极输

2、出高电平。RBRC5VUBUCT矩形波脉冲信号参数:AT0.1A0.5A0.9Atptrtf脉冲幅度A:脉冲信号变化的最大值。脉冲上升时间tr:从幅度的10%上升到90%所需时间。脉冲下降时间tf:从幅度的90%下降到10%所需时间。脉冲宽度tp:从上升沿的50%到下降沿的50%所需时间。AT0.1A0.5A0.9Atptrtf脉冲周期T:波形周期性重复出现所需的最短时间。脉冲频率f:单位时间内出现的脉冲个数,与周期T成 倒数。占空比:矩形波脉冲宽度tp与脉冲周期T的百分比值。8.1 数制与码制一个数可用数制和码制两种形式来表示。数制 按进制表示;码制用编码表示。常用数制的表示1.十进制数表示

3、2. 二进制数表示3. 任意进制数表示4. 数制的转换码制8421码、2421码、余3码、格雷码等1. 十进制数表示特点:逢十进一表示方法:用10的幂相加表示称:10i 权(进位基数的幂)2. 二进制数表示特点:逢二进一表示方法:用2的幂相加表示 称:2i权(进位基数的幂)3. 任意进制数表示称:Ri权(进位基数的幂)称:R进位基数称:Ki为相应的系数将一个数从一种进制表示转换为另一种进制表示,称之。4. 数制的转换二进制十进制的转换按权展开十进制二进制的转换整数:除2取余; 小数:乘2取整。例:将(159)10 ( )21592余 179239余 12余 1219余 12924221余 1余

4、 0余 0快速转换法:例:将(0.875)10 ( 0. )2码 制数字电路处理的信号,都可以用多位二进制数来 表示,这种二进制数叫代码,给每个代码赋予一定含 义的过程叫编码。若需要编码的信息数量为N,则用作代码的二进 制数的位数n应该满足:若某一编码的二进制数的每一位都有一固定的 权值,这类编码称为有权码;反之,则为无权码。几种常用的二进制编码见表8.1.1(P278)概述:开关电路应用的电子器件是数字电路的基本元 件。它只有接通和断开两种状态,所以,只有两种取 值“0”和“1”,我们把这种二值变量称为逻辑变量 。把数字电路的输出信号和输入信号之间的关系称为 逻辑关系或逻辑函数。数字电路所进

5、行的二值运算就 叫逻辑运算,研究这种运算规律的数学叫逻辑代数( 布尔代数)。因此,数字电路也称为逻辑电路。逻辑代数中的“0”和“1”与十进制的0和1有着完全 不同的含义,在逻辑代数中,0和1代表着对立或矛盾 着的两个方面,如开关的接通和断开,信号的有和无 ,电位的高和低等等,视具体研究对象而定。8.2 逻辑运算与逻辑门电路1. 与逻辑及“与”门电路决定事件F的所有条件A和B都满足时,事件F才发生,则称 逻辑函数F是逻辑变量A和B的“逻辑与”。逻辑表达式为:与逻辑门电路:与逻辑门符号:与逻辑真值表A B F0 0 0 1 1 0 1 10001运算规则:基本逻辑运算与基本门2. 或逻辑及“或”门

6、电路决定事件F的所有条件A和B只要有一个或一个以上得到满 足时,事件F就发生,则称逻辑函数F是逻辑变量A和B的“逻辑 或”。逻辑表达式为:或逻辑门电路:或逻辑门符号:或逻辑真值表: A B F 0 0 0 1 1 0 1 10111运算规则:3. 非逻辑及“非”门电路决定事件F的条件A不具备时,事件F才发生,则称逻辑函 数F是逻辑变量A的“逻辑非”。逻辑表达式为:非逻辑门电路:非逻辑门符号:非逻辑真值表A F1 0 01 运算规则:1. 与非逻辑运算及“与非”门与非逻辑是与逻辑和非逻辑的 结合。其逻辑函数表达式为:与非逻辑真值表A B C F0 0 0 0 0 1 0 1 0 0 1 1 1

7、0 0 1 0 1 1 1 0 1 1 111111110与非逻辑门:与非逻辑特点: 全“1”出“0”,有“0”出“1”复合逻辑运算与其他门电路2.或非逻辑运算及“或非”门或非逻辑是或逻辑和非逻辑的 结合。其逻辑函数表达式为:或非逻辑真值表A B C F0 0 0 0 0 1 0 1 0 0 1 1 1 0 0 1 0 1 1 1 0 1 1 110000000或非逻辑门:或非逻辑特点:全“0”出“1”,有“1”出“0”3.与或非逻辑运算及“与或非”门与或非逻辑是与逻辑、或逻辑和非 逻辑的结合。其逻辑函数表达式为:与或非逻辑真值表A B C D F 0 0 0 0 0 0 0 1 0 0 1

8、0 0 0 1 1 1 1 1 111100与或非逻辑门:4.异或逻辑运算及“异或”门和同或逻辑运算及“同或”门设F(A、B)为变量A、B的逻辑函数,只有当A、B 取值相异时(即A=1,B=0或A=0,B=1),函数F(A、B )的取值为1,否则为0,我们称F(A、B)为异或逻辑函 数,实现异或逻辑运算的电路称为异或门。异或逻辑真值表:异或逻辑门异或逻辑表达式为: A B F 0 0 0 1 1 0 1 10110(1)异或逻辑运算及“异或”门设F(A、B)为变量A、B的逻辑函数,只有当A、B 取值相同时(即A=1,B=1或A=0,B=0),函数F(A、B )的取值为1,否则为0,我们称F(A

9、、B)为同或逻辑函 数,实现同或逻辑运算的电路称为同或门。同或逻辑真值表同或逻辑门同或逻辑表达式为:A B F0 0 0 1 1 0 1 11001=A B(2)同或逻辑运算及“同或”门5. 三态门三态门就是指具有三种输出状态的门电路,即:它除了可 输出高电平和低电平以外,还可以有第三种输出状态高阻 态(也称禁止状态)。此时,输出端相当于悬空,和所有电路 断开(内部结构了解)。三态门的逻辑符号:三态门与普通门的区别在于,它的输入端有一个控制信号 输入端:EN 称为使能端。高电平使能低电平使能ENABCF高电电平使能F低电电平使能 0 0 1 10 1 0 1高阻 高阻 0 10 1 高阻 高阻

10、三态门真值表1010正逻辑与负逻辑高电平=1,低电平=0 正逻辑高电平=0,低电平=1 负逻辑在判断某一具体逻辑电路的逻辑功能时,首先应该 明确该电路采用的是正逻辑还是负逻辑。同一电路由 于采用的逻辑约定不同,其逻辑关系也不相同。可以证明正、负逻辑函数间满足如下对偶关系:除特别声明以外,本 教材均采用正逻辑。1)正逻辑与门即为负逻辑或门;2)正逻辑或门即 为负逻辑与门(例如下页);3)正逻辑与非门即 为负逻辑或非门;4)正逻辑或非门即为负逻辑与 非门;5)正逻辑异或门即为负逻辑同或门;6)正 逻辑同或门即为负逻辑异或门。A B F0 0 0 1 1 0 1 10001如图:开关组成的门电路约定

11、正逻辑:开关闭“1”,断“0”灯亮“1”,灭“0”则负逻辑:开关闭“0”,断“1”灯亮“0”,灭“1”A B F0 0 0 1 1 0 1 10111F=A BF=A+B8.3 逻辑代数的运算法则基本法则基本规则基本定理逻辑代数运算的基本法则 0A=0 1A=A AA=A A=00+A=A1+A=1A+A=AA+=1逻辑代数运算的基本定理定理1 交换律定理2 结合律定理3 分配律定理4 吸收律定理5 对和律定理6 反演律异或运算的主要公式逻辑代数运算的基本规则1. 代入规则任意一个逻辑等式,如果将等式中所有出现某一变量的地 方,都用同一个逻辑函数去置换,则此等式仍然成立。2. 反演规律3. 对

12、偶规则对任意一个逻辑函数F,如果将其中的“”变成“+”, “+”变 成“”; “0”变成“1”;“1”变成“0”所得到的新的逻辑函数F称 为原函数的对偶式。当已知逻辑函数F,欲求则只要将F中的所有“”变成“+” “+”变成“”;“0”变成“1”;“1”变成“0”。原变量变成反变量,反变 量变成原变量,即得 。逻辑函数的化简卡诺图化简(后一节内容中介绍)因为同一逻辑函数可以写成不同形式的逻辑表达式 ,在逻辑电路的设计中,逻辑函数最终都要用逻辑电路 来实现,因此,用最简单的逻辑函数设计电路是简化电 路、降低成本和提高系统可靠性的最直接的方法。公式化简法1.并项法 2.吸收法 3.消去法 4.配项法

13、逻辑函数的公式化简法1.并项法利用对合律将两乘积项合并,使逻辑函数 得到简化。化简:2.吸收法利用吸收律,吸收多余的与项,使逻辑函数 简化。3.消去法利用吸收律,消去某些与项中的变量,使逻 辑函数得到简化。4.配项法利用基本公式给逻辑函数配上适当的项,使 逻辑函数得到简化。证毕1.化简 解:8.4 简单组合逻辑电路的分析和设计组合逻辑电路的分析并介绍函数的卡诺图化简1.步骤2.举例分析和设计组合逻辑电路时,须要讨论它的输出 变量与输入变量间的逻辑函数关系。逻辑分析就是分 析已给逻辑电路的逻辑功能,找出输出逻辑函数与输 入逻辑变量之间的逻辑关系。逻辑电路的设计,也称 为逻辑电路的综合,它是分析的

14、一个相反过程。组合逻辑电路的设计1.步骤2.举例1.分析组合逻辑电路的步骤大致如下: 组合逻辑电路的分析写逻辑式列逻辑状态表分析逻辑功能已知 逻辑图运用逻辑代数化简或变换2.举例例1:分析图示逻辑电路的逻辑功能解:(1)由 逻辑图写出 逻辑式:(2)由逻辑式写出逻辑真值表:异或逻辑真值表A B F0 0 0 1 1 0 1 10110(3)分析逻辑功能得出门电路:异或逻辑门组合逻辑电路的设计1.设计组合逻辑电路的步骤大致如下: 写逻辑式画出逻辑图2.举例例2:试设计一逻辑电路供三人(A、B、C)投票使用,每 人有一电键,如果他赞成,就按电键,表示“1”,如果他不赞成 ,就不按电键,表示“0”。表决结果用指示灯来表示,如果多数 赞成,则指示灯亮,F=1;反之不亮,F=0。已知 逻辑要求列逻辑 状态表运用逻辑代数化简或变换该题共有三人参加投票,所以 应该有8种组合,如下表:ABCF 0000 0010 0100 0111 1000 1011 1101 1111从表中可见,在8种组合中 ,F=1只有4种。a.由表中F=1列写正逻辑函 数表达式。c.各种组合之间是或的逻辑 关系故取以上各项乘积之和 ,由此写出逻辑关系式。b.对一种组合而言,输入变 量是“与”逻辑关系。对应于 F=1,如果输入变量为1。则

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 中学教育 > 教学课件

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号